Iron Content in Orange Juice

Orange juice is not typically known as a significant source of iron. Naturally, the iron content in fresh orange juice is quite low, often less than 1% of the daily recommended intake per serving. This is because oranges and their juice primarily provide vitamin C and other antioxidants, rather than substantial amounts of iron.

However, many commercially available orange juices are fortified with iron to help address iron deficiency in certain populations. Fortification is the process of adding nutrients to foods to improve their nutritional value. When orange juice is fortified, the iron content can vary significantly depending on the brand and formulation.

Natural Iron Content in Orange Juice

  • Fresh, unfortified orange juice typically contains around 0.1 to 0.2 mg of iron per 8-ounce (240 ml) serving.
  • This amount represents roughly 1-2% of the daily value (DV) for iron, which is about 18 mg for most adults.
  • The iron present in natural orange juice is non-heme iron, which has a lower absorption rate compared to heme iron found in animal products.

Fortified Orange Juice and Iron Levels

  • Fortified orange juice can contain anywhere from 3 mg to 6 mg of iron per 8-ounce serving.
  • This fortification level provides approximately 15-35% of the recommended daily iron intake.
  • Fortified iron in orange juice is often in a form that is better absorbed when consumed alongside vitamin C, which orange juice naturally contains in high amounts.

Impact of Vitamin C on Iron Absorption

One of the key nutritional benefits of orange juice is its high vitamin C content. Vitamin C significantly enhances the absorption of non-heme iron. This means that even though natural orange juice contains low iron levels, the iron that is present can be absorbed more efficiently than from other plant sources lacking vitamin C.

Factors Influencing Iron Absorption from Orange Juice

Despite low iron content in natural orange juice, it plays a vital role in enhancing iron absorption from other dietary sources. This effect is primarily due to its high vitamin C (ascorbic acid) content, which significantly improves non-heme iron bioavailability.

  • Vitamin C Content: Orange juice is rich in vitamin C, which can reduce ferric iron (Fe3+) to the more absorbable ferrous iron (Fe2+).
  • Non-Heme Iron Absorption: Non-heme iron, found mostly in plant-based foods, is less readily absorbed. Consuming orange juice with meals containing non-heme iron can increase absorption efficiency.
  • Phytates and Polyphenols: Certain compounds in meals, such as phytates and polyphenols, inhibit iron absorption. Vitamin C in orange juice can counteract these inhibitors to some extent.

Comparing Iron in Orange Juice with Other Common Sources

To contextualize the iron contribution of orange juice in the diet, the following table compares its iron content with other common food and beverage sources:

Food/Beverage Iron Content (mg per typical serving) Notes
Natural Orange Juice (8 fl oz / 240 ml) 0.1 – 0.2 mg Low iron content, high vitamin C
Fortified Orange Juice (8 fl oz / 240 ml) 2.0 – 3.6 mg Moderate iron source due to fortification
Cooked Spinach (½ cup) 3.2 mg Plant-based iron source, contains inhibitors
Beef (3 oz cooked) 2.1 mg Heme iron, highly bioavailable
Lentils (½ cup cooked) 3.3 mg Good plant-based iron source
